for the benefit of the Natives particularly the females. Being
apprised of my writing to you She & Ellen unite in affectionate
regards to you, with, my dear Friend, yours very affectionately
and sincerely H Henry
Don't fail to write & let me have all the interesting information
you can, and among other things about Mr & Mrs Cover; concerning
whom I have had some information from Mr & Mrs Gyles. If you should
be acquaint with them remember me affectionately to them, and tell them
I should be very glad to hear from them, & will write to them if they write to me.
Excuse this hasty Scrawl.
Mr Hayward is gone to the Colony in the Haweis, but
intends to return. one object he has in view is, I believe, to get
a Partner. It is is very doubtful whether he will get one there that will suit him.
